New kit for Holme Speedwatch

Cambridgeshire FIRE & RESCUE SERVICE

H

olme village has, for a long time, had considerable concern about the speed of traffic travelling through the village. As a result the Holme Speedwatch Team of volunteers was formed, supported by Cambridgeshire constabulary, and has been in operation for about 18 months with the goal of educating drivers to observe the speed limits. In November the speed limit on the B660 was reduced from 40 mph to 30 mph, requiring a greater presence to remind drivers of their responsibilities to observe the new limit. Previously we were sharing police provided equipment with 2 other villages so could only hold sessions every three weeks, which reduced our impact and as a result speeding vehicles rose back up to circa 25% of all through traffic. We are delighted that thanks to the support of Big Lottery Funding, Holme Forties Weekend Committee and a generous benefactor who lives in the village, we now

have our very own Speedwatch kit and will be able to hold sessions as often as we like. Our heartfelt thanks goes to those organisations. We have a cheerful band of 12 volunteers (some of whom are in the picture with our new kit) who go out in all weathers to remind drivers of their responsibilities to drive within the posted speed limits and as a result we hope to be able to reduce our speeding to a very low percentage, 0% is our ultimate aim, for the benefit of all residents as well as motorist using our roads. Women’s World Day of Prayer is an international, ecumenical, prayer movement that invites women, from a different part of the world each year, to prepare a worship service through which their hopes and fears for their country may be brought before the whole world in prayer.

O

n Friday 4 March an estimated 3 million people in over 170 countries and islands will gather to observe the day of prayer, using an order of service written by Christian women in Cuba and translated into over 60 languages and 1000 dialects. In the British Isles alone over 6,000 services will be held. The day begins as the sun rises over the island of Samoa and continues until it sets off the coast of American Samoa, some 35 hours later. The theme ‘Receive children. Receive me’ reflects St Mark’s Gospel, chapter 10 verses 13-16, which is the

focus of the service and a reminder that everyone is a child of God and equally worthy of our love and respect. The Republic of Cuba is the largest Caribbean island, located at the entrance of the Gulf of Mexico and called ‘the Key to the Gulf’. Politically at odds with the USA, Cuba suffered greatly due to the economic embargo imposed upon it in 1960 but has found strength within itself to move on and overcome many of its problems. Keeping divorce costs down Divorce costs often hit the headlines when we learn that multimillionaires have spent £000’s on their divorce, but in reality the “average” divorce costs much less and there are ways to keep the costs down. Top tips for keeping costs down  Take advantage of a free initial consultation At Woolley & Co we offer a free 30 minute consultation which allows us to obtain basic information about you and your circumstances and we can then discuss key issues in your situation and the options for dealing with them.  Consider all options for resolving any disputes There are now a number of methods for discussing and settling the financial and other issues that arise on separation or divorce such as negotiation or mediation. A lawyer will explore these with you. There is no “one size fits all” solution.  Do your homework A lawyer cannot give you definite advice about a proposed financial settlement without full information. You can prepare by gathering together the documents and information your lawyer requires as early as possible.  Do some thinking too Consider where you and your children will live. If you want to stay in your home can you afford to do so? If the house is sold, could you afford to purchase a suitable property for you and your children? Speak to mortgage advisors to find out what your mortgage capacity is and to estate agents to see how much other suitable properties may cost.  Be clear on the costs from the start Your Lawyer should give you a breakdown of all the likely costs involved and in many cases will be able to offer a fixed price for the divorce or other money pit. Sensible advice coupled with sensible people can help to ensure the experience is as painless and cost effective as possible but more importantly that you and your children can move forward with your lives in the best possible way. Taxation Question: I have received two invoices for items I had purchased and one invoice charged me VAT on the postage, whilst the other did not. Should I have been charged VAT on the postage? Answer: It’s a common misapprehension that all post is exempt from VAT, but the position is more complicated than that and businesses should to be aware of the correct position. The basic position is that posting letters or parcels with the Royal Mail Group PLC (Post Office) is exempt from VAT, but that does not apply to businesses recharging those costs. Any other courier or delivery costs charged by delivery companies other than the Post Office are subject to VAT at the standard rate. Many businesses make a charge for delivery of goods and in many cases the delivery is undertaken by the Post Office and the costs incurred by the business are exempt from VAT. HMRC take the view that there are two separate supplies; the supply by the Post Office to the business which is exempt from VAT; and the supply of the delivered goods by the business to it’s customer. When a business is making a supply of delivered goods, they are making a single ‘composite supply’ and the liability of the postage charges follows that of the goods. You should therefore have been charged VAT on the postage by both of your purchases. Claiming back VAT on business trips: The rules for recovering VAT in expenses incurred on a business trip can be something of a minefield. Apart from not knowing whether or not VAT is recoverable, another common problem is knowing whether the costs have VAT on them to begin with. You can generally reclaim the VAT on travel and subsistence expenses where a director, partner, sole proprietor or employee is away from their normal place of work on a business trip. The business must pay for the actual cost or a proportion of the actual cost. You can’t reclaim VAT on expenses if you pay an employee a flat rate per day or night. However, if you pay for the exact cost of the expense and the employee keeps the invoice then you can reclaim the VAT.

National Yorkshire Pudding Day by Louise Addison

From 2008 the first Sunday in February has been designated National Yorkshire Pudding Day!

T

he traditional Yorkshire Pudding first got its name in 1747 according to local legend, when Hannah Glasse wrote a cookery book titled The Art of Cookery Made Plain and Simple. She included a Yorkshire Pudding recipe; but no-one really knows how far back the original recipe goes as some form of batter or dripping pudding, as it was previously named, has been cooked for centuries. Early puddings were flatter than today’s version and were cooked in a tin beneath the meat, which was roasted on a spit over a fire. The pudding was positioned to catch all the drippings from the meat. Dripping was an important part of the diet in those days because the human body actually needs some fat to enable it to absorb certain vitamins, but unlike today sources of fat were more difficult to obtain as meat was expensive so was only cooked on special occasions. Extra drippings from any meat added a welcome and much-needed supplement. The Yorkshire pudding was usually made in a large tray, and was often served with gravy before the main meal as a filler, so less meat was required for the main course. The recipe is pretty simple, just eggs, milk and plain flour. A Yorkshire-born aunty once warned me never to use self-raising flour, or any kind of raising agent because doing so will mean your puds will be spongy and soggy. Also the batter has to be the right consistency, a little thicker then unwhipped double cream, and as smooth as possible. To achieve the best, most crispy Yorkshire puds trickle about 3mm / 1/8 inch of very hot fat in the bottom of the tin, then heat it up. As the fat begins to smoke, add the batter. Enjoy!

Toad in the Hole Preparation time: 20 minutes Cooking time: 40 minutes Serves: 4 Ingredients 100g plain flour ½ tsp English mustard powder Good pinch of salt 1 egg 300ml milk 1 tsp dried thyme 8 plain pork sausages 2 tbsp sunflower oil 2 onions, peeled and sliced 1 tsp soft brown sugar 500ml good quality beef stock

FOOD

Recipe

Method For the Batter  Preheat oven to 220C / gas 7. Sift the flour, salt and mustard powder together into a large mixing bowl. Make a well in the centre or the flour, crack in the egg, then pour in a little milk. Stir with a wooden spoon or a balloon whisk, gradually incorporating some of the flour. Keep adding milk and continue stirring until all the milk and flour has been mixed together and the batter is smooth and lump-free. It should be the consistency of unwhipped double cream. Stir in the thyme.  Place the sausages into a 20 x 30cm roasting tin. Add 1 tbsp of the oil, tossing the sausages in it to thoroughly coat the base of the tin, then roast in the oven for 15 mins.  Remove the hot tray from the oven, then quickly pour in the batter – it will sizzle and bubble a little when it hits the hot fat. Return the tray to the oven. Bake for 40 mins until the batter is cooked, well risen and crispy. For the Gravy Cook the onions with the remaining oil gently in a non-stick pan until they are golden brown. Caramelise them by adding the sugar for the final 5 minutes. Add the spoonful of flour, then cook, stirring continuously, for 2 mins. Gradually pour in the stock, stirring well to make a smooth sauce. Simmer for 4-5 mins to thicken, then season to taste. Cut the toad in the hole into large wedges and serve with the gravy spooned over.

Stay safe and say ‘No’ to Doorstep Traders Rogue traders cause misery for thousands of people each year; most of which are the elderly and vulnerable in our communities. These uninvited traders call at properties offering to do home maintenance work such as roofing, tarmacing and paving, garden and tree surgery, insulation, general building work, burglar alarms and other services. The work or service offered can sometimes be unnecessary, overpriced, of a poor standard or not done at all. Typically they have no formal training to carry out the work offered and some may have links with distraction burglars. It is important that people have the confidence to say NO

to doorstep traders and take the time to think about the service being offered. If you have an experience with a rogue trader, please report it by telephoning 101. For live incidents where the rogue trader is still at the property, or is due to return, contact the police on 999. The police have a protocol for dealing with these incidents and welcome your contact. If you need a recommendation for a safe, approved local trades person, go to www.safelocaltrades.com or call free on 0800 014 1832.

The following is advice on how people can avoid being scammed by rogue doorstep traders: • Be cautious; if a trader knocks at your door, DO NOT agree to on the spot house repairs without taking advice • Be wary of special offers or warnings that your house is unsafe • Don’t allow anyone to pressure you into agreeing to have work carried out; if you ask them to leave and they don’t, contact the police on 999 • Do not make snap decisions; if you feel that any work is required on your property, take time to talk to family or neighbours before you make a decision • Don’t ever go to a bank or cash point with a trader; legitimate traders would never do this!

Making your garden bird-friendly WINTER Winter is notoriously a difficult time of year for birds, and figures from bird monitoring schemes suggest that populations of the most widespread species have dropped by around 421 million across Europe since 1980.

F

ood is hard to come by in winter, making it extremely important that we do everything we can to encourage birds into our gardens throughout the winter. Here, Adrian Nind, Managing Director at Bakker Spalding Garden Company, provides four top tips for making your garden bird-friendly.

1

Feed the birds!

There has long been a downward trend of birds in gardens in the UK. Since 1979, starlings visiting gardens in winter have dropped by 84% since the RSPB Big Garden Birdwatch began. During the cold weather, food can become scarce for birds so we need to give them a helping hand. Don’t forget that birds will only feed where they feel safe, so always place the food approximately 1.75m high in a place with an open view, and implement squirrel baffles to keep squirrels away. There is a huge range of food and shelters available for birds which is perfect for the winter months.

2

Make your garden somewhere to forage

In addition to providing bird seed and leftover food, there are a variety of plants and trees which can attract birds to your garden and provide food throughout the winter. It’s important to create somewhere for birds to forage and feed in our gardens. Make sure you wait to tidy borders and cut shrubs until late winter and early spring – this will help retain seeds and fruit for birds. Fruiting bushes are also a great source of food for birds during the winter. So don’t prune too much just yet!

3

Encourage safe habitats

Make sure that any bird boxes in your garden have ventilation holes at the top and drainage holes below. They should also be placed out of danger of any predators. During the winter, nest boxes should be cleared of any old nest material to prevent pests and diseases

TIPS

spreading to next year’s occupants, but now is a good time to start ensuring that you have suitable nesting materials available in your garden. One of our customers is known to regularly groom her dog and place all the fur from the brush into her hedges for the birds to nest with.

4

Keep water sources clean and accessible

Alongside a supply of food, birds need to have access to a supply of water all year round – not just to drink, but also to bathe and keep their feathers in good condition. Ponds provide water for birds and attract additional wildlife to your garden. However, it is likely they may freeze over throughout winter so remember to break up any ice in harsh weather. If a bird bath gets completely frozen, remove all the ice and refill so that the birds always have access to some water.

Give your pet something to smile about! We all know the importance of looking after our own teeth – brush our teeth twice daily, regular checkups with a Dentist etc. But how often do you think about your pet’s dental health?

D

ental problems are one of the common ailments we see – a shocking 80% of cats & dogs over the age of 3 years have a degree of dental disease. Their problems differ from ours – where we suffer more commonly with tooth decay and demineralisation, our pets suffer more commonly with periodontal disease. Periodontal disease is a bacterial infection affecting the gums and bone around the tooth and it originates from plaque build-up. Plaque is a mixture of bacteria and proteins derived from saliva and food which naturally accumulate in the mouth where it sticks to the teeth. It can be easily removed, but after 48 hours the plaque calcifies and becomes a grey or brown hard substance called tartar(which is difficult to remove). The bacteria and tartar build up cause the gums to inflame (gingivitis) and recede, where it progresses to infection and destruction of the tooth socket. This damage is irreversible and painful, often leading to losing the tooth. The bacteria associated with periodontal disease can also enter the bloodstream and there is evidence it can cause damage to major organs including the heart, liver and kidneys. So looking after our pet’s teeth is more than just avoiding bad breath!

26

How do you know if your pet is suffering from periodontal disease? Bad breath is the first indication. Gums which bleed during chewing, reluctance to eat and excessive drooling are also common signs. If you are worried about your pet’s dental health, please see your Vet for a checkup. What can you do about it? In the early stages any discomfort can be reversed and damage prevented by removing the plaque. This is done most effectively by daily brushing, but there are also special foods, chews and supplements that can help. If you want to know more about the dental products and tooth brushing, please book appointment with your Veterinary Nurse. IMPORTANT: Be sure to use Veterinary approved toothpaste Human toothpaste often contains Xylitol which is poisonous to dogs and fluoride which can be harmful to both cats and dogs. In the later stages of periodontal disease, professional Veterinary treatment will be necessary. Under general anesthetic the Vet can remove tartar (including cleaning below the gumline where bacteria also accumulate) both by hand and by using ultrasonic cleaning equipment. The Vet can also remove any painful and damaged teeth at this time.

Tooth brushing tips

• Get your pet used to ha ving their face handled – rub and stroke your pe t’s face around the mouth regularly – don’t forget to reward them with pla y or a small treat. Repeat da ily for at least 5 days. • Start by using your fing ertip with a little pet toothpaste. Keeping you r pet’s mouth closed, be gin with the canine teeth an d work backwards down the inside of their cheeks . Do this gradually over the course of a few sessions. For now ignore the inside surface of the teeth and the small incisor teeth at the front, they are often the most difficult. • Once your pet is happ y with this, start to includ e the incisor teeth in you r routine. • Progress to a specially designed toothbrush wh en your pet is comfortable with the finger brushing . • You may now also includ e the inside surfaces of the teeth when they are use d to the toothbrush. • Start young – it is gene rally better accepted. BU T it’s never too late – older pets can learn too. • Be patient – it’s a stran ge sensation for our pe ts and it takes time for the m to accept it . • ONLY use Veterinary ap proved toothpaste.

the language of

flowers

By Susan Brookes-Morris It’s nearly Valentine’s Day and millions will be rushing out to buy or send flowers. Traditionally this will be red roses of course. Others may choose their purchases on the basis of colour, smell or even price but there’s a whole language and meaning to flowers too which is called Floriography. Roses: - Red Roses as most will know symbolise Love and Desire but changing the colour of the flower leads to different connotations. For example, Yellow is for friendship, Pink for perfect happiness and Orange for fascination. There are different meanings for specific types of rose too, such as Tea Roses meaning ‘I’ll remember always’ and Dog Roses connecting to pain and pleasure. Formations also have an impact. Thinking back to the traditional dozen red roses, a bunch of a single bloom, means I love you or I still love you, whilst an assortment of colours represents the sentiment ‘you’re everything to me.’ A dozen red roses has become the norm, because of the significance of the number twelve within nature, philosophy and religion. The number 12 often represents a full cycle, so 12 months of the year, 12 signs of the zodiac, 12 hours on a clock for instance. From ancient times, cultures around the world have developed calendars based on cycles of twelve, and there are many mythological and religious connections to the number also. The use of 12 across the natural and spiritual world means that 12 or a dozen, has taken on a universal quality which enhances the significance of a dozen roses. Turning now to other flowers we frequently buy in the UK: Carnations:- Pink carnations mean ‘I’ll never forget you,’ whilst red symbolise admiration and yellow rejection and disappointment, so probably best to avoid those! Lilies: - Calla Lilies represent beauty and Tiger Lilies wealth so the latter is perhaps a good choice if you are looking to impress. Tulips: - Apparently show love and passion too. Yellow ones which are my daughter’s favourite, mean ‘there’s sunshine in your smile,’ whereas red tulips are a declaration of love and white ones say ‘I’m worthy of you.’ Daffodils: - Show regard. Freesias: - Demonstrate trust. Of course there are many more wonderful flowers to choose from, so if you really want to be sure of making the right impression, it’s worth asking your florist about their meaning.
